This is a lightweight and straightforward pedal; packed with features they are not. If you ride or race in the mud and have experience with clipless pedals, we think you could appreciate these. Due to their small body and lack of adjustability, we wouldn’t likely recommend them as anyone’s first pair of clipless pedals. The lack of platform and support makes them best suited for use with very rigid soled shoes. See it ranked against other top products in our mountain bike pedal review.
